    Sung Sot Cave

    A place so amazing that the French deemed it “Grotte des Surprises” or (Surprise Grotto), Sung Sot Cave is one of the biggest, most beautiful caves in Halong Bay and a highlight on most Halong Bay itineraries. The cave can be found on the island of Bo Hon, along with another popular Halong cave, Trinh Nu. From the dock below, visitors must climb 50 stairs to the grotto’s mouth, which is just 25 meters above the sea. Sung Sot Cave is divided into two chambers; the first chamber, known as the “Waiting Room” is vast, adorned by stalagmites and stalactites and lit by multicolored lights positioned to complement the chamber’s structural beauty. n order to reach the second chamber, visitors must walk down a narrow passageway. The second chamber is known as the “Serene Castle”. This chamber is large and grand with an extremely high ceiling and has many interesting rock formations which locals identify by likening them to animals due to their shapes.

    Hang Luon Cave

    Halong Bay is not a strange destination for tourists who love discovering the magnificent appearance of this world heritage. Whenever mentioning Halong Bay, many people will think about a bay with thousands of limestone islets in various sizes and shapes. Inside the mountains are a world of sparkling caves that are decorated by stunning stalactites and stalagmites. Unlike the common caves in Halong Bay, Luon Cave is a unique one, which is no less attractive than the others. Luon Cave is a part of Bo Hon Island, which is about 14 kilometers from the mainland of Bai Chay City. Known as the island of amazing things, Bo Hon Island is an outstanding location in Halong Bay that most tourists choose as a nextstop on their way discovering Halong Bay. The surrounding area of Luon Cave comprises a lot of well-known places of interest in Halong Bay. In front of Luon Cave is Con Rua Island (Turtle Island), and on the right of this cave is the Heaven Gate.

    Ti Top Island

    Ti Top Island is favored for its enchanting scenery and pleasant weather. These elements make Ti Top Beach a not-to-be-missed destination for tourists on the journey of exploring Halong Bay, especially those who love nature in Vietnam. This Island is preferable for tourists when taking Halong Bay tours, thanks to its ideal location. Specifically, Bo Hon Island and Sung Sot Cave are ahead of the island, while Dam Nam Island is to the right, and Cua Luc Bay is at the backside. Moreover, Ti Top Beach is located only about 7-8 kilometers away from Bai Chay Tourist Area to the Southeast.
